FTC, states sue Amazon for anti-competitive practices

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) in conjunction with attorneys general from 17 states filed an antitrust lawsuit against Amazon on Tuesday. The lawsuit alleges that the tech giant has leveraged its dominant market position to inflate product prices and stifle competition. The FTC alleges that Amazon's third-party e-commerce business engages in anti-competitive practices. For instance, it forces sellers to purchase Amazon's advertising and delivery services, with fees for such services accounting for approximately 50 percent of a seller’s income.
